
A Recipe For Tallahassee's Perfect Compost
Clip: Season 6 Episode 7 | 6m 9sVideo has Closed Captions
We look at the components needed to create compost perfect for your yard.
We look at the various layers that go into making a “compost lasagna" and how Turkey Hill Farm works with a local seafood restaurant to turn leftover kitchen scraps into the perfect addition to soil. Learn more at https://wfsu.org/ecolgyblog.
